Few embody this transformation more strikingly than Capt. Vijay Nicodemus, the COO of Adhira Shipping & Logistics. A man who once commanded vessels on the high seas, Capt. Vijay made the rare and bold move to leave the captain’s chair and dive headfirst into the corporate realm. His journey from Cadet to Captain was already a feat. The greater test came when he chose to come ashore, trading a secure and lucrative seafaring life for the uncertain promise of growth on land.

Beginning anew as an Operations Manager in Hong Kong, he navigated the unfamiliar waters of shore-based logistics with the same determination that had once guided him across oceans. With time and through relentless perseverance, he rose through leadership roles across Indian ports before assuming the mantle of COO. Today, his name is synonymous with adaptability and grit. Among his recognitions, he especially cherishes the “Resilient Leader” title awarded during the COVID-19 crisis at Karaikal Port, a testament to his calm under pressure. Yet, for Capt. Vijay, the real rewards lie in successful projects and collective team milestones.

In what ways have your past experiences influenced your approach to leadership in your current role as COO?

While I stepped away from sailing, my connection to the shipping industry remained strong and uninterrupted. Serving as a Captain provided me with invaluable hands-on experience at sea, allowing me to understand the intricacies of maritime operations from a practical standpoint. However, when I transitioned to shore-based operations, I encountered an entirely different set of challenges that required a broader perspective and a more strategic approach.

Upon returning to India, I embraced a variety of roles across several major ports. These responsibilities included everything from managing stevedoring operations to overseeing commercial activities. Over time, I progressed into executive leadership, where I was entrusted with driving performance and managing complex logistics.

One of the most pivotal moments in my professional journey occurred during the COVID-19 pandemic. Faced with an unprecedented global crisis, we had to respond rapidly by introducing new standard operating procedures, rotating a limited workforce, and maintaining uninterrupted port operations. Ensuring the port remained fully functional without a single day of shutdown during this period was a defining achievement that highlighted the value of preparedness, strong leadership, and adaptive risk management.

How do you envision the future of the shipping and logistics industry?

Unlike the tech industry, which thrives on automation and digital platforms, the shipping sector is deeply rooted in physical operations. While advancements in technology will undoubtedly improve efficiency, they cannot replace the essential human involvement required in critical areas such as cargo loading, vessel navigation, and port management. Looking toward the future, I see immense potential in the African continent. Adhira Shipping is actively pursuing growth by expanding into mining logistics and exploring transshipment opportunities across several African nations. This region remains largely underdeveloped in terms of logistics infrastructure, presenting a unique and promising opportunity for emerging players like us to make a meaningful contribution while also achieving sustainable, long-term growth.
